Classes available:
Reiki I--Self Healing with Reiki: "To heal others, to heal the world,
we must first learn to heal ourselves." This class introduces the student to Reiki with an
emphasis on self-healing and includes a level I attunement. Prerequisites: none except a willingness to learn and a desire to heal.
Reiki II--Reiki Practitioner:
This class builds on the learning from Reiki I and
enables the student to work as a Reiki Practitioner.
Topics include: opening to intuition, distance healing, and Reiki symbols.
A level II attunement is included.
Prerequisites: Reiki I class and Reiki self-healing experience.
Reiki III--Reiki Master: The subject of this class is learning to teach Reiki and includes a level III attunement.
Before and after the actual class, I am available as a mentor to Reiki Master candidates.
Prerequisites: Reiki II class, healing experience, and a written letter of intent asking to become a Reiki Master.

I teach Reiki in a variety of settings. In addition to traditional day long workshops,
I conduct classes by request for individuals, couples, and small groups.
These smaller classes tend to be more personalized and can more easily focus on students' individual healing issues.
I have studied "learner-centered education" and have applied these principles to my Reiki classes.
All my classes have at least three components: discussion, attunement, and practicum.
During the discussion phase, essential knowledge is shared between student and teacher.
The attunement is a ritual where the ability to do Reiki is actually transferred.
During the practicum, students have the opportunity to practice Reiki.
